What is Window Reglazing?

Window reglazing is the process of getting rid of old, damaged glazing (the putty or sealant around the window panes), fixing or changing broken glass, and then resealing the window frame with new glazing product. This approach revitalizes aging windows without the need for a complete replacement, extending their lifespan and improving performance.

The Window Reglazing Process

The reglazing procedure can be broken down into several actions. Here's a comprehensive introduction:

Step 1: Assessment

Before any work begins, a comprehensive examination of the windows is performed. This includes monitoring for fractures, gaps, or moisture damage. Property owners must keep in mind any particular concerns they want attended to during the reglazing procedure.

Step 2: Removal of Old Glazing

The old putty or sealant around the window panes is thoroughly removed utilizing a putty knife or scraper. This step can be labor-intensive, specifically in older homes where the glazing material may be especially persistent.

Step 3: Repair or Replace Glass

When the old glazing has been gotten rid of, any damaged glass can be fixed or changed. This is a critical step that identifies the effectiveness of the reglazing procedure. Cracked or missing panes should be changed to make sure ideal efficiency.

Step 4: Clean the Frame

After removing the old glazing, the frame is cleaned to eliminate any dirt, dust, and remnants of the old glazing material. This prepares the surface area for the brand-new sealant.

Step 5: Application of New Glazing

A new glazing substance is used around the edges of the window pane to produce an airtight seal. This compound ought to be thoroughly smoothed to supply a cool surface and a proper seal.

Step 6: Finishing Touches

Finally, the reglazed window is painted or completed to safeguard the brand-new glazing and enhance the overall appearance.

Step 7: Final Inspection

A final evaluation makes sure that the window is effectively sealed and working as intended. Homeowners need to examine for drafts, leaks, or noticeable imperfections.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Just how much does window reglazing expense?

The expense of window reglazing differs depending upon aspects like the size of the window, the degree of damage, and labor costs in your location. On average, property ow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 100 per window.

2. For how long does window reglazing last?

When done appropriately, reglazed windows can last anywhere from 15 to 30 years. The durability mainly depends on the quality of products utilized and maintenance.

3. Can I reglaze my windows myself?

While DIY reglazing is possible, it's suggested that property owners hire professionals for the best outcomes. Experienced professionals can make sure a proper seal and manage any complex repair work.

4. Does window reglazing improve energy effectiveness?

Yes, reglazing can substantially improve energy efficiency by sealing gaps and repairing damaged glass, which assists reduce heating & cooling costs.

5. When should I consider window reglazing over replacement?

If your windows are traditionally significant, in excellent basic condition, and just need small repairs, reglazing may be the very best alternative. Conversely, if the frames are decaying or the windows are thoroughly damaged, replacement may be essential.
